Niacinamide

What is this?

A white vitamin powder.

Scientific Data (PubChem)

Verified chemical structure and identification data sourced from public registries.

PubChem CID 938
Molecular Formula C6H6N2O
Synonyms nicotinamide, niacinamide, 98-92-0, 3-Pyridinecarboxamide

Common Uses & Applications

Brightens dull skin. It gives the product a nice feel and keeps it fresh. This makes it popular for things we use every day.

Comprehensive Risk Profile

Human Health Impact

Clinical Risk: Low risk.

Can make skin red and warm.

Environmental Impact

It is safe for the earth. It breaks down fast in water.
